Does Cawdor or Birnam have better schools?

On average school ICSEA (the ACARA index that benchmarks educational advantage), Birnam scores 971 vs 966 in Cawdor. ICSEA is a school-community indicator, not a quality rating, so always check NAPLAN results and catchment boundaries for the specific address you're considering.
